Android耗电优化实践 (二)Android耗电优化Android耗电优化实践 (一)- 利用Hook方式监控排查耗电Android耗电优化实践 (二)- 检测错误的UI绘制刷新导致的耗电检测错误的UI绘制刷新导致的耗电排除由于错误的绘制方法,导致CPU占用过高,进而导致耗电量高检测方式参考大众点评App的短视频耗电量优化实战首先打开开发者选项,打开GPU视图更新的开关,然后看看应用内部有哪些
转载
2023-07-13 17:26:51
428阅读
一、前言
所谓App Widgets就是微型应用程序的意思,它可以嵌入在其他应用程序(如主屏幕),并能定期更新其View。 这些View被当成用户界面的小部件,您可以使用App Widget provider来发布App Widgets。 一个能容纳其他的App Widgets的应用程序的组件,我们称之为App Widget host。
图1
就是一个音乐A
转载
2023-07-13 17:28:31
65阅读
日历类QCalendarWidget 主要用于选择一个日期。直接继承自QWidget,外观如下:属性值字面解释如下:PropertiesdateEditAcceptDelaydateEditEnabled : bool 设置是否可编辑firstDayOfWeek : Qt::DayOfWeek 一个星期默认的第一天,上面即西方的“周日”,第一列gridVisible
转载
2023-12-12 09:51:02
73阅读
作者简介Derek Yang,携程资深研发经理,专注于iOS开发&跨端技术研究,热衷于新技术探索。一、前言2020年9月苹果发布了iOS 14.0,相较之前有了很大的功能改观,很重要的一点是用户可以更加个性化的定义自己的桌面,Widget就是这项功能的主角。近期接到一项产品需求,需要实现若干机票业务相关的Widget,此文总结该需求开发上线过程中的踩坑填坑经验。Widget俗称小组件,是苹
转载
2023-07-13 17:26:01
169阅读
授权为了让提醒事项和日历事件能工作起来,你需要依赖于EventKit。你将也需要一个持久化的存储来保存备忘录项。因此,EventKit为你提供了这个:EKEventStore。一个EKEventStore允许你从用户日历数据库中更新、创建、编辑和删除事件。提醒事项和日历数据都存储在日历数据库。在理想情况下,你整个应用将只有一个事件存储器,而且你只能实例化其一次,那就是EKEventStore对象需
转载
2023-07-13 17:40:54
142阅读
1. 首先,移动设备的耗电大户主要是下面几大方面。 The CPU. Wi-Fi, Bluetooth, and baseband (EDGE, 3G) radios WIFI 网络链接、蓝牙、基带射
转载
2023-07-07 21:59:25
332阅读
大家好,我是你们的老朋友小信。在和平精英中,不同的设备带来的游戏体验也不尽相同,很多玩家表示安卓容易掉帧,但是ios玩家也有自己的烦恼,接下来我们就来说说用ios的玩家都有哪些弊端吧~电量提示相信很多iOS玩家都经历过被弹出来的电量提示消息打断过,如果在一般时刻还好,要是在关键时刻来这么一下子,那颗要了命了,甚至很多玩家本来能吃鸡就因为这一下子泡汤了。明暗度还有玩家表示自己的iOS手机还有个问题,
转载
2024-01-16 05:00:17
83阅读
比起安卓,iOS有一些优点统一的通知推送赏心悦目的动效也有一些缺点不支持分屏模式闹钟没有智能工作日无法一键关闭后台无法应用双开App Store服务器不稳定文件管理不方便本地视频播放器不完善没有骚扰来电识别这些已经被反反复复提到, 我将根据使用体验,说几点大家极少提及的。 1.GPS/WIFI/蓝牙快捷快关控制 在安卓上,下拉中心可以控制所有开关。然
转载
2024-01-11 12:16:36
0阅读
什么是Widget?其实Widget 不是一个新名词,它在程序开发中有它的含义“窗口小部件”,在 Web 2.0 领域里所提的 Widget,还没有一个明确的翻译,大概可以理解为“应用小插件”,一种可供自己制作和自由下载的小工具,它包含了娱乐、工作、学习等多种实用功能。Widget可以在电脑桌面上单独执行,网民无需通过浏览器便连接到网络。时至今日,很多人已对苹果、雅虎、Google及微软放出的桌面
转载
2023-11-08 19:20:54
195阅读
iOS 小组件widgetwidget可以让用户快速访问他们认为重要的信息, 如今天的天气, 股价, 日程表, 或者快速的执行一个任务
如果用户允许, 小组件可以出现在锁屏界面:They do so in the “Allow Access When Locked” area by going to Settings > Touch ID & Passcode > Notif
转载
2023-07-13 14:10:26
290阅读
# iOS 10 Widget关闭方案
iOS 10是苹果公司推出的操作系统,其中Widget是其一项重要特性,允许用户在主屏幕快速查看信息或执行操作。但有时用户可能需要关闭某些Widget,本文将提供一种关闭iOS 10 Widget的方案。
## 项目背景
Widget是iOS系统中的一个便捷功能,它允许用户在不打开应用的情况下快速获取信息或执行操作。然而,随着用户需求的多样化,有些Wi
原创
2024-07-26 08:15:29
134阅读
学习如何从第三方应用程序制作可自定义的小部件和小部件。可以在任何装有 iOS 14 或更高版本的 iPhone 上执行此操作。 要制作小部件,首先从应用商店下载第三方应用,例如 Widgetsmith。在主屏幕上,点击并按住直到您在左上角看到一个加号。点击此添加小部件。如何制作小部件在这些步骤中,我们将使用应用程序Widgetsmith创建一个小部件。您可以从 App Sto
转载
2023-07-24 14:34:01
97阅读
不少朋友总是抱怨自己的苹果很耗电,刚买的时候,一天一充就够了。但是现在,一天要两充甚至是三充、四充。其实,想要让你的苹果更省电,是有方法的,只要关闭苹果手机里一些耗电设置即可。那么下面就一起来看看吧~ 一、关闭耗电设置1.关闭后台应用刷新后台应用刷新,顾名思义,开启的话,手机里的各种应用会在后台不断的刷新,但是频繁刷新,会逐渐消耗我们手机的电量。所以,想要进一步节省手机电量的朋友,可以关闭这一
转载
2023-05-31 11:12:51
292阅读
flutter学习之widget的显示和隐藏1、Visbility组件2、Offstage组件3、Opacity组件4、 通过组件的size控制5、空组件占位法 在IOS的开发中,我们对于控件的隐藏和显示, 只需要设置hidden属性, 因为是View的一个基本属性,但是在flutter开发中确是没有直接的属性给你设置, flutter本着万物皆widget的原则。所以flutter中想要实现实
转载
2023-07-25 07:58:50
192阅读
iOS性能优化之耗电量前言最近在测试App的时候,发现手机特别容易发烫,我们都知道 ,如果手机容易发烫,那么耗电量肯定会相当大,手机电量使用的时间也会相对少;对此,我在工作之余抽了点时间,对手机的耗电量进行了一些研究,希望可以给大家起到抛砖引玉的作用,对自己的App进行相应的优化,(在我们的能力范围内 ,系统问题我们暂时没还得靠苹果大佬那边进行优化)让我们的手机电量的使用时间更长些。一、耗电量相关
转载
2023-12-27 22:34:47
45阅读
引言 本系列文章作者是安卓开发,以安卓开发的视角学习IOS小组件,记录一下踩坑记录,如有讲得不对的地方,路过大佬多包涵。如果你是想深入学习小组件,建议您顺着笔者的编号顺序阅读本系列文章。如果曾经了解过,只需要了解部分,则可以挑选来看。另外本系列文章中代码全部是Swift语言编写。本文大纲小组件是什么?小组件概述小组件开发备注小组件实现原理小组件是什么?小组件概述WidgetKit 通过在 iOS
转载
2023-08-31 20:59:21
121阅读
如今使用IT数码设备的小伙伴们是越来越多了,那么IT数码设备当中是有很多知识的,这些知识很多小伙伴一般都是不知道的,就好比最近就有很多小伙伴们想要知道在硬件参数大致相当的前提下为什么 iPhone 远比安卓手机更流畅,那么既然现在大家对于在硬件参数大致相当的前提下为什么 iPhone 远比安卓手机更流畅都感兴趣,小编就来给大家分享下关于在硬件参数大致相当的前提下为什么 iPhone 远比安卓手机更
转载
2023-09-04 11:18:20
378阅读
聊下 在项目里面 做展开和折叠 这个功能在iOS10 才出现的 并且样式 跟 iOS10 以下 是有点不一样的, iOS9 的左边 是留了一定的间距,而iOS10 是在屏幕的两边留了大概 7 的宽度。1.首先 TestWidgetDemo 的 ViewController.m 里面加入一个控制器 用于控制是否展开和折叠NSUserDefaults *def = [[NSUserDefault
转载
2023-08-19 16:05:50
134阅读
展开全部手机一直开着蓝牙不会很耗电以下是测试蓝牙耗e68a84e8a2ad62616964757a686964616f31333366303766电量的对比图:从结果来看,正常待机跟开着蓝牙待机,耗电量没增加多少。连接了蓝牙设备后,增加了一倍的耗电量。一旦蓝牙设备开始工作,则耗电量呈10倍增量。根据上图可以有选择地开启关闭外接的蓝牙设备即可。至于手机开着蓝牙待机基本不会很耗电。扩展资料:手机省电小
转载
2023-08-17 23:01:06
835阅读
前言:小组件的开发和我们正常情况开发App的逻辑是一样的,正常情况分为:网络请求,数据模型,view,渲染.只不过是小组件的开发使用了 swiftUI 语言来编写,所以要对SwiftUI的空间有所了解.好!那我们接下来开始我们的小组件开发吧.首先,创建Widget Extension然后选择证书,起个名字.然后左侧的文件列表底部会出现一个文件夹这个就是我们的小组件啦!现在可以直接运行了.系统默认显
转载
2023-09-26 16:28:20
89阅读